The fortified hill town of Rye in East Sussex once boasted high town walls and gates, only one town gate still survives. Remnants of the towns walls can still be found, however, their dominance and impressive presence in the town and surrounding area have been lost. "One of the old gates to the medieval Laguardia"

Karol Karolkiewicz

"The west gate, which we chose to enter because it's close to the free parking. This is the valley viewpoint. The east gate, the Butchers' Gate, is perhaps more interesting to enter during your visit to Laguardia, as it leads directly to the Plaza Mayor. From this gate, there's also free parking and an elevator to ascend the slope, which may be more interesting during your visit.
In any case, the four gates are very well maintained and have real wooden doors to close them."

valentin VS

"The Pagan Gate is right in front of the valley viewpoint and we used it to enter the walled part of this beautiful site."

Jose Amador Teira Gude
